Open Targets MCP — disease/target/drug knowledge graph that integrates genetic, genomic, transcriptomic, and chemistry evidence. Keyless GraphQL public endpoint.

Part of Pipeworx — an MCP gateway connecting AI agents to 1476+ live data sources.

Tools

  • target(ensembl_id) — target (gene) profile
  • disease(efo_id) — disease profile
  • drug(chembl_id) — drug profile
  • search(query, entity?, size?) — platform search
  • target_associations(ensembl_id, size?) — top diseases for a target
  • disease_associations(efo_id, size?) — top targets for a disease
  • target_known_drugs(ensembl_id, size?) — clinically tested drugs for a target

Data source

https://api.platform.opentargets.org/api/v4/graphql

What this endpoint actually serves

tools/list at https://gateway.pipeworx.io/opentargets/mcp returns the tools in the table above plus the shared Pipeworx meta-toolsask_pipeworx, discover_tools, search_within, remember/recall and the rest of the gateway-wide set. So the tool count you see is larger than this table: a single-pack endpoint currently lists roughly 30 shared tools alongside the pack's own. The connection's initialize response states its exact scope, and is the authoritative answer for a given day.

This is deliberate, not multiplexing by accident. The meta-tools are what let a scoped connection answer a question this pack does not cover — via ask_pipeworx, which routes across the whole catalog — without you adding a second MCP server. There is currently no way to mount a pack endpoint without them; if the extra schemas cost you more context than the routing is worth, connect to the full gateway once rather than to several pack endpoints.
